What is the SportDB MCP Server?

Turn your AI agent into a dedicated sports analyst with SportDB. Query real-time match data, historical league tables, and deep player intelligence across multiple sports — all through natural conversation.

What you can do

  • Live Match Tracking — Retrieve real-time scores for football, basketball, hockey, and tennis as they happen
  • League Standings — Fetch full league tables with points, wins, draws, losses, and goal difference for any season
  • Fixture Schedules — Browse completed and upcoming matches for specific leagues and seasons
  • Match Deep Dive — Inspect individual matches with lineups, formations, substitutions, and in-game statistics
  • Club Intelligence — Search for clubs, view profiles with stadium information, and retrieve current squad rosters
  • Player Analytics — Search players, view career profiles, seasonal statistics, and complete transfer histories

How it works

  1. Subscribe to this server
  2. Enter your SportDB API Key from the SportDB Dashboard
  3. Start querying sports data from Claude, Cursor, or any MCP-compatible client

Your agent navigates the entire competition hierarchy — from country to league to season to match — so you never have to dig through sports websites manually.

Built-in capabilities (18)

get_club_players

Requires the numeric club ID. List all players currently registered to a specific club

get_club_profile

Requires the numeric club ID obtained from search results. Get the full profile of a club by its ID

get_competition_seasons

g., "premier-league"), returns all available seasons. Use this to find the season identifier needed for standings and fixtures queries. List available seasons for a specific competition

get_country_competitions

g., "england", "spain", "germany"), returns all competitions available in that country. The response includes competition slugs needed to drill deeper into seasons and standings. List competitions (leagues/cups) available in a specific country for a sport

get_fixtures

Includes dates, teams, scores for completed matches, and upcoming schedule. Requires sport, country_slug, competition_slug, and season. Get scheduled and completed match fixtures for a season

get_live_basketball

Use this when the user asks about ongoing basketball games or live NBA/EuroLeague results. Get live basketball match scores happening right now

get_live_football

Use this when the user asks about ongoing football games, current scores, or live results. Get live football (soccer) match scores happening right now

get_live_hockey

Use this when the user asks about ongoing hockey games or live NHL/KHL results. Get live ice hockey match scores happening right now

get_match

Use the match_id obtained from fixtures or live results. Get detailed information for a specific match by its ID

get_match_lineups

Returns player names and positions for each side. Get starting lineups and substitutions for a specific match

get_match_stats

Requires a valid match_id. Get in-match statistics for a specific match

get_player_profile

Requires the numeric player ID obtained from search results. Get the full profile of a player by their ID

get_player_stats

Requires the numeric player ID. Get career and seasonal statistics for a specific player

get_player_transfers

Requires the numeric player ID. Get the complete transfer history of a specific player

get_standings

Requires sport, country_slug, competition_slug, and season (e.g., "2024-2025"). This is the primary tool for answering "who is top of the league" questions. Get league table standings for a specific season of a competition

list_countries

The sport parameter should be a slug like "football", "basketball", "hockey", or "tennis". Use this as the starting point to navigate the competition hierarchy. List all countries available for a given sport

search_clubs

Returns a list of matching clubs with their IDs and basic metadata. Use this to find a club ID before requesting its profile or player roster. Search for clubs/teams by name keyword

search_players

Returns matching players with their IDs and basic profile data. Use this to find a player ID before requesting their detailed profile, statistics, or transfer history. Search for players by name keyword

Can my AI agent show me live football scores while I work?

Yes! Simply ask your agent to run the get_live_football tool and it will instantly retrieve all ongoing matches with real-time scores, minute markers, and status updates. You can also use get_live_basketball or get_live_hockey for other sports.

02

How do I find the Premier League standings for the current season?

Navigate the hierarchy: first use list_countries with sport 'football', then get_country_competitions for 'england', then get_competition_seasons for 'premier-league', and finally get_standings with the season slug. Your agent can chain these steps automatically from a simple question like 'Show me the Premier League table'.

Can the integration modify any data on SportDB, or is it strictly read-only?

All 18 tools are strictly read-only query operations. The integration cannot create, update, or delete any data on SportDB. Your API key is used solely for authenticated reads, ensuring your account remains safe from any destructive operations.

What is Agent mode and why does it matter for MCP?

Agent mode is Cursor's autonomous execution mode where the AI can perform multi-step tasks: reading files, editing code, running terminal commands, and calling MCP tools. Without Agent mode, Cursor operates in a simpler ask-and-answer mode that doesn't support tool calling. Always ensure you're in Agent mode when working with MCP servers.

05

Where does Cursor store MCP configuration?

Cursor looks for MCP server configurations in a mcp.json file. You can configure servers at the project level (.cursor/mcp.json in your project root) or globally (~/.cursor/mcp.json). Project-level configs take precedence.

06

Can Cursor use MCP tools in inline edits?

No. MCP tools are only available in Agent mode through the chat panel. Inline completions and Tab suggestions do not trigger MCP tool calls. This is by design. tool calls require user visibility and approval.

07

How do I verify MCP tools are loaded?

Open Settings → Features → MCP and look for your server name. A green indicator means the server is connected. You can also check Agent mode's available tools by clicking the tools dropdown in the chat panel.

08

Tools not appearing in Cursor

Ensure you are in Agent mode (not Ask mode). MCP tools only work in Agent mode.

09

Server shows as disconnected

Check Settings → Features → MCP and verify the server status. Try clicking the refresh button.
